摘要:
An in-depth study of RESO (recomputing with shifted operands) theory is conducted which leads to the extension of the theory so that efficient CED designs for two-dimensional array structures and complex functions can be achieved. Based on the enhanced version of RESO, a systematic design strategy has been developed to allow the designer to take advantage of knowledge of fault configurations.
